The Science of Rest

 

Sleep is an intricate biological procedure necessary for physical and psychological health and wellness. It involves unique phases, controlled by circadian rhythms and influenced by hormonal activity. Understanding these elements is critical for appreciating exactly how they affect sleep high quality and general wellness.

 

Stages of Rest

 

Rest consists of several phases, mostly categorized into rapid eye movement (Rapid-eye-movement Sleep) and non-REM stages. Non-REM sleep is additional separated right into three phases: N1, N2, and N3.

 


  • N1: Light rest, where one can be conveniently awakened.

  • N2: Modest sleep, critical for memory combination.

  • N3: Deep rest, important for physical recovery and growth.

  •  

 

REM sleep occurs concerning 90 minutes after going to sleep and is crucial for dreaming and cognitive features. Each cycle lasts roughly 90 mins and repeats a number of times during the evening. A sleep medical professional highlights the significance of stabilizing these stages to make certain restorative rest.

 

Circadian Rhythms and Sleep-Wake Cycle

 

Body clocks are natural, inner procedures that repeat approximately every 24 hours and regulate the sleep-wake cycle. These rhythms respond to environmental signs, mainly light and darkness.

 

The suprachiasmatic core (SCN) in the brain manages these rhythms, influencing melatonin manufacturing. Melatonin, a hormone launched in reaction to darkness, signifies the body to plan for rest. Interruption of circadian rhythms, such as with change work or uneven sleep patterns, can result in rest disorders, fatigue, and reduced performance. Sleep physicians advise keeping consistent rest schedules to support these biological rhythms.

 

Hormones and Their Impact on Rest

 

Hormonal agents play a substantial role in controling rest patterns. Besides melatonin, cortisol is one more essential hormonal agent that influences rest.

 


  • Melatonin: Promotes sleepiness and controls circadian rhythms.

  • Cortisol: Usually described as the stress hormone, peaks in the morning to promote alertness however can interfere with rest if raised throughout the evening.

  •  

 

Other hormonal agents, like growth hormone, are released during deep sleep, supporting tissue repair and muscular tissue growth. Disruptions in hormonal balance can cause sleep problems or hypersomnia. Consulting a sleep doctor can help evaluate hormonal impacts on sleep quality.

 

 

Usual Rest Disorders

 

Rest conditions can dramatically interfere with every day life and effect total wellness. Recognizing these usual problems can assist in recognizing signs and looking for proper treatment.

 

Sleeping disorders

 

Insomnia is identified by trouble falling or remaining asleep. Individuals might experience a series of signs and symptoms, consisting of tiredness, state of mind disruptions, and impaired focus. Reasons can be varied, including stress and anxiety, anxiety, inadequate sleep habits, or clinical conditions.

 

Treatment frequently entails behavior modifications, such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y for Sleep Problems (CBT-I). This method resolves the underlying thoughts and habits influencing sleep. In many cases, medication might be suggested for short-term alleviation, but it's not constantly advised for chronic insomnia.

 

Sleep Apnea

 

Rest apnea entails repeated disruptions in breathing throughout sleep. The most usual type is obstructive sleep apnea, where the throat muscle mass intermittently relax and block the respiratory tract. Signs include snoring, wheezing for air during rest, and daytime fatigue.

 

Diagnosis typically involves a sleep study. Therapy alternatives might consist of way of life adjustments, continuous favorable respiratory tract stress (CPAP) devices, or surgical procedure in extreme instances. Taking care of rest apnea is crucial, as it can lead to significant wellness problems, consisting of cardio issues.

 

Uneasy Legs Syndrome

 

Agitated Legs Syndrome (RLS) causes an uncontrollable urge to relocate the legs, often accompanied by uncomfortable sensations. Symptoms worsen at night or in the evening, resulting in difficulties in dropping off to sleep. Elements contributing to RLS may consist of genetics, iron deficiency, and certain medicines.

 

Administration approaches usually include lifestyle adjustments, such as regular workout and preventing caffeine. In some instances, medications like dopaminergic agents or anticonvulsants might be essential to reduce symptoms and improve rest high quality.

 

Narcolepsy

 

Narcolepsy is a neurological disorder influencing the brain's ability to regulate sleep-wake cycles. People commonly experience too much daytime drowsiness, abrupt sleep attacks, and, sometimes, cataplexy, which is a sudden loss of muscle mass tone set off by strong feelings.

 

Diagnosis generally entails a sleep study and multiple rest latency examinations. Treatment focuses on handling signs and symptoms through medicines that promote wakefulness and behavior adjustments. Staying notified concerning triggers can enhance the quality of life for those influenced by narcolepsy.

 

 

Influence of Sleep on Health And Wellness and Well-being

 

Appropriate rest is vital for preserving ideal health and wellness and well-being. Rest straight affects physical wellness, frame of minds, and immune function, highlighting the requirement for people to focus on corrective remainder.

 

Physical Wellness Effects

 

Not enough sleep can result in several physical wellness concerns. Persistent rest deprival is associated with a boosted danger of conditions such as weight problems, diabetes mellitus, and heart diseases.

 

When sleep patterns are disrupted, hormones managing cravings and metabolic rate might be affected. This imbalance can bring about harmful weight gain.

 

Furthermore, numerous rest specialists highlight that high quality sleep is necessary for muscle recovery and cells fixing. Individuals that routinely get appropriate rest usually report greater power levels and boosted physical performance.

 

Mental Wellness and Cognitive Impacts

 

Rest is intricately connected to psychological health and wellness and cognitive performance. Poor sleep high quality can intensify symptoms of stress and anxiety and anxiety, resulting in a cycle of agitation and emotional distress.

 

Cognitive processes such as memory loan consolidation and decision-making are substantially jeopardized with inadequate rest.

 

Research study shows that individuals might deal with emphasis and problem-solving capabilities when denied of remainder. Those that visit extensive sleep facilities commonly obtain assessments that highlight the link in between rest high quality and psychological well-being.

 

Improving rest health can enhance mood and cognitive clarity, making rest a crucial part of psychological health strategies.

 

Sleep and Immune System Feature

 

The immune system relies greatly on high quality rest to function efficiently. Throughout deep rest, the body generates cytokines, proteins that play a vital role in combating infections and swelling.

 

Rest deprivation can lower immune responses, making individuals a lot more susceptible to disease.

 

Sleep experts note that chronic lack of remainder might bring about a raised probability of viral infections and extended recovery times. To keep durable immune function, prioritizing sleep is necessary.

 

Incorporating good rest methods into daily regimens can strengthen resistance and general health.

 

 

Methods for Better Rest

 

Applying efficient approaches can significantly boost rest top quality and total health and wellbeing. The adhering to methods focus on creating a helpful rest atmosphere and developing habits that advertise corrective remainder.

 

Sleep Health

 

Rest hygiene involves techniques that develop ideal problems for sleep. Crucial element include keeping a consistent rest routine and creating a comfy rest atmosphere.

 


  • Consistency: Going to sleep and waking up at the same time every day aids regulate the body's body clock.

  • Atmosphere: An awesome, dark, and peaceful bedroom advertises better rest. Take into consideration power outage curtains, eye masks, or white noise equipments to shut out disturbances.

  • Limit Naps: Short snoozes can be helpful, yet long or irregular napping during the day can negatively affect nighttime rest. Aim for 20-30 minute snoozes if needed.

  •  

 

Avoid electronics and brilliant displays at the very least one hour before going to bed to lower blue light direct exposure, which can disrupt melatonin production.

 

Diet regimen and Exercise

 

Diet plan and workout play essential roles in sleep health. Eating the right foods at appropriate times can improve sleep top quality.

 


  • Dish Timing: Avoid square meals close to going to bed. Rather, go with light snacks that are high in carbs and reduced in healthy protein.

  • High levels of caffeine and Alcohol: Decrease caffeine consumption, particularly in the mid-day and night. Alcohol may assist fall asleep however can interfere with rest cycles later in the night.

  •  

 

Normal physical activity adds to better sleep. Engaging in modest exercise, such as walking or biking, for a minimum of 30 minutes most days can assist with rest onset and period. Nevertheless, exercising as well close to going to bed can have the opposite impact, so go for earlier in the day.

 

Leisure and Tension Management Methods

 

Reliable leisure and stress monitoring strategies can aid calm the mind before rest.

 


  • Mindfulness and Reflection: Techniques such as deep breathing, meditation, or yoga can decrease stress and anxiety levels and promote leisure. They help reduced cortisol, a hormonal agent that can hinder rest.

  • Going to bed Ritual: Develop a relaxing pre-sleep regimen. Activities like reading or taking a warm bath signal to the body that it's time to relax.

  •  

 

Avoid psychologically charged conversations or tasks right prior to bedtime, as they can boost anxiety and tension.

 

 

Expert and Clinical Treatments

 

Seeking professional assistance is vital for resolving sleep issues efficiently. Different treatments, varying from consultations with sleep specialists to particular treatments, can dramatically improve sleep health.

 

When to Seek Advice From a Rest Physician

 

Individuals need to take into consideration seeking advice from a sleep doctor if they experience consistent rest issues such as persistent sleep problems, rest apnea, or serious snoring. Observing signs like extreme daytime sleepiness or difficulty focusing can also indicate a need for specialist assistance.

 

A sleep medical professional, usually part of a thorough sleep center, can carry out evaluations to identify sleep disorders. These professionals make use of tools like rest studies, which monitor breathing, heart price, and brain task during rest. Early intervention can prevent lasting health and wellness problems and boost general quality of life.

 

Therapies Offered by Sleep Centers

 

Extensive rest facilities use a range of therapy options tailored to certain rest problems. Therapies might include cognitive behavior modification (CBT) for sleeping disorders, which effectively attends to adverse thought patterns surrounding rest.

 

Rest centers also supply Continual Positive Air passage Stress (CPAP) treatment for those identified with rest apnea. This tool supplies a continuous flow of air to keep respiratory tracts open throughout rest, substantially reducing sleep disruptions.

 

Furthermore, rest specialists may suggest way of life modifications, such as enhancing rest health, developing a consistent rest timetable, and reducing high levels of caffeine consumption. These changes can boost the performance of clinical treatments.

 

Medications and Behavior Modification

 

Sometimes, drugs may be recommended to deal with sleep disturbances. Common options include benzodiazepines and non-benzodiazepine sleep help. These drugs can assist handle symptoms, yet they are usually advised for temporary use as a result of potential adverse effects.

 

Behavior modification matches medicine by helping people establish healthier sleep practices. Strategies such as leisure training, stimulus control, and rest limitation treatment can be efficient in dealing with sleep problems.

 

Incorporating medication with behavior modification frequently results in much better results. Each approach targets various aspects of sleep wellness, contributing to more efficient and lasting services for people experiencing sleep difficulties.

 

 

Technological Improvements in Sleep Researches

 

Current growths in innovation have changed sleep research studies, providing better devices for comprehending rest patterns and conditions. These improvements include using wearable tools, home examinations, and cutting-edge therapies for rest apnea.

 

Wearable Sleep Trackers

 

Wearable rest trackers have obtained appeal because of their comfort and ease of access. Tools such as smartwatches and health and fitness bands monitor sleep period, top quality, and patterns. They usually make use of sensing units to gauge heart price, body language, and sometimes body temperature level.

 

Users can obtain detailed analyses of their rest phases, such as rapid eye movement and deep rest. Numerous trackers additionally offer customized insights to boost rest hygiene. These understandings frequently include suggestions for modifications in bedtime routines or environmental adjustments.

 

The data collected can be synced with mobile applications, permitting customers to monitor sleep trends over time. This makes wearables an important device for both individuals and healthcare providers looking to boost rest wellness.

 

Home Rest Tests

 

Home sleep examinations (HSTs) offer an alternative to traditional lab-based rest studies. These tests are created to diagnose rest conditions, generally rest apnea, in the convenience of one's home. People can use mobile monitoring tools that capture crucial rest metrics, such as airflow, oxygen degrees, and heart price.

 

HSTs are less invasive and a lot more cost-effective than overnight remain in a rest center. The data from these tests is normally analyzed by sleep professionals, who can then advise proper therapy. Therefore, home rest examinations are coming to be an essential part of modern sleep medication.

 

Raised availability to these examinations enables even more people to seek aid for sleep concerns than in the past. It is important, nonetheless, that they enhance medical assessments for precise medical diagnoses.

 

Breakthroughs in Rest Apnea Therapy

 

Recent advancements in the therapy of sleep apnea consist of constant positive respiratory tract pressure (CPAP) treatment technologies and the advancement of different tools. Standard CPAP devices can be difficult, bring about compliance concerns; nevertheless, more recent designs are more small and quieter.

 

Additionally, oral devices developed to rearrange the jaw during sleep have actually become extra reliable. These appliances are tailored per individual's demands, making them a desirable choice for numerous.

 

Minimally intrusive medical options are additionally offered for certain cases of rest apnea. These procedures intend to attend to anatomical issues that contribute to air passage obstruction. With these developments, individuals have a larger variety of treatment alternatives to manage their rest apnea efficiently.

 

 

Developing a Sleep-Conducive Environment

 

A well-structured rest environment is critical for promoting top quality rest. Secret facets include maximizing the bedroom design, taking care of light and noise, and choosing the appropriate bedding. Each aspect adds substantially to overall sleep wellness.

 

Optimizing Your Bedroom for Sleep

 

Producing a dedicated sleep area includes careful consideration of the room's layout. The room must be without interruptions and mess, advertising relaxation. Placing the bed away from the door and making sure comfy temperature levels can improve comfort.

 

Choosing soothing colors for walls and decor can create a calming environment. Soft, soft tones like pale blues or greens are typically suggested. Furthermore, maintaining a clean and tidy environment helps in reducing anxiety, making rest a lot more easily accessible.

 

The Function of Light and Sound Control

 

Controlling light degrees is crucial for indicating the body when it is time to sleep. Power outage drapes or shades can obstruct outdoors light sources effectively. Lowering lights an hour before bedtime prepares the body for rest.

 

Sound control is similarly important. Making use of white noise equipments can mask disruptive audios. Earplugs or soundproofing procedures can even more enhance the bedroom's acoustic setting, promoting uninterrupted rest cycles.

 

Bedding and Rest Comfort

 

Picking the best bed linens is necessary for enhancing rest comfort. A cushion that suits specific preferences-- whether firm or soft-- plays a substantial function. Cushions ought to sustain the head and neck appropriately, customized to sleeping settings.

 

Picking breathable fabrics for sheets can aid regulate temperature level. All-natural materials like cotton or bamboo are commonly advised for their comfort and moisture-wicking residential or commercial properties. Layering coverings enables flexibility to changing temperatures throughout the night.

Shift Job and Its Difficulties

 

Shift job positions specific obstacles to sleep wellness. Individuals functioning non-traditional hours typically experience a disrupted body clock, causing trouble sleeping or staying asleep. This can cause extreme exhaustion and reduced performance.

 

Numerous change workers report concerns such as sleeping disorders and lowered sleep duration. Incorporating strategic snoozes throughout breaks and adhering to a constant rest timetable can aid alleviate a few of these difficulties.

 

The Economic Influence of Rest Disorders

 

Sleep disorders carry significant economic effects for culture. Estimates suggest that sleep-related problems cost organizations billions annually in lost productivity and boosted medical care expenditures. Problems like insomnia or obstructive sleep apnea typically lead to higher absenteeism prices.

 

Buying work environment rest programs can lower these prices. Companies that promote sleep health with education and resources may see improved employee performance and reduced turn over rates. As understanding of sleep health expands, attending to these problems ends up being progressively essential for both individuals and organizations.
